The Gyle 59 Brewery. Spring fed, log powered, propane driven, unfined, hazy crazy artisan beers. We want you to notice what you are drinking.

All our beers are created with one thing in mind - flavour. We are lucky enough to have a unique supply of spring water which we are using to good effect allowing the many different qualities of our ingredients to shine through.

Bottle split with James, 30/08/15. Amber with reddish hues, decent off white covering. Nose is straw, lemon rind, earthy, spice. Taste comprises rye bread, light floral, spice, citric tinged, wooded notes, faint red berry must. Medium bodied, fine carbonation, semi drying close. Decent saison.

Bottle split with and thanks to James, 30/08/15. Light black with limited tan bubbledom. Nose is dark fruits, treacle toffee, toasted brown sugar, molasses. Taste comprises chocolate, light roast, earthy red berry, pinch of spice, light charr, toffee, good coffee vibes. Medium bodied, fine carbonation, drying close. Decent stout.
